Range and Efficiency
While the Renault Zoe Z.E. 50 R135 (2019-2024) offers a longer real-world range and a bigger battery, it is less energy-efficient than the Renault 5 E-Tech EV40 120hp (2024-...).
| Property | Renault 5 E-Tech EV40 120hp | Renault Zoe Z.E. 50 R135 |
|---|---|---|
| Range (WLTP) | 194 mi | 239 mi |
| Range (GCC) | 165 mi | 203 mi |
| Battery Capacity (Nominal) | 43 kWh | 54.7 kWh |
| Battery Capacity (Usable) | 40 kWh | 52 kWh |
| Efficiency per 100 mi | 24.2 kWh/100 mi | 25.6 kWh/100 mi |
| Efficiency per kWh | 4.13 mi/kWh | 3.9 mi/kWh |
| Range and Efficiency Score | 6.1 | 6.5 |
Charging
Both vehicles utilize a standard 400-volt architecture.
The Renault 5 E-Tech EV40 120hp (2024-...) offers faster charging speeds at DC stations, reaching up to 80 kW, while the Renault Zoe Z.E. 50 R135 (2019-2024) maxes out at 50 kW.
The Renault Zoe Z.E. 50 R135 (2019-2024) features a more powerful on-board charger, supporting a maximum AC charging power of 22 kW, whereas the Renault 5 E-Tech EV40 120hp (2024-...) is limited to 11 kW.
| Property | Renault 5 E-Tech EV40 120hp | Renault Zoe Z.E. 50 R135 |
|---|---|---|
| Max Charging Power (AC) | 11 kW | 22 kW |
| Max Charging Power (DC) | 80 kW | 50 kW |
| Architecture | 400 V | 400 V |
| Charge Port | CCS Type 2 | CCS Type 2 |
| Charging Score | 5.2 | 6.9 |
Performance
Both vehicles are front-wheel drive.
Although the Renault Zoe Z.E. 50 R135 (2019-2024) has more power, the Renault 5 E-Tech EV40 120hp (2024-...) achieves a faster 0-60 mph time.
| Property | Renault 5 E-Tech EV40 120hp | Renault Zoe Z.E. 50 R135 |
|---|---|---|
| Drive Type | FWD | FWD |
| Motor Type | EESM | EESM |
| Motor Power (kW) | 90 kW | 100 kW |
| Motor Power (hp) | 120 hp | 134 hp |
| Motor Torque | 166 lb-ft | 181 lb-ft |
| 0-60 mph | 8.6 s | 9.1 s |
| Top Speed | 93 mph | 87 mph |
| Performance Score | 2.7 | 2.5 |
